public class DeadLetterJobEntityManagerImpl extends AbstractEntityManager<DeadLetterJobEntity> implements DeadLetterJobEntityManager
| Modifier and Type | Field and Description |
|---|---|
protected DeadLetterJobDataManager |
jobDataManager |
jobServiceConfiguration| Constructor and Description |
|---|
DeadLetterJobEntityManagerImpl(JobServiceConfiguration jobServiceConfiguration,
DeadLetterJobDataManager jobDataManager) |
create, delete, delete, deleteByteArrayRef, findById, update, updategetClock, getCommandContext, getEventDispatcher, getJobServiceConfiguration, getSessionprotected DeadLetterJobDataManager jobDataManager
public DeadLetterJobEntityManagerImpl(JobServiceConfiguration jobServiceConfiguration, DeadLetterJobDataManager jobDataManager)
public List<DeadLetterJobEntity> findJobsByExecutionId(String id)
DeadLetterJobEntityManagerDeadLetterJobEntity instances related to an ExecutionEntity.findJobsByExecutionId in interface DeadLetterJobEntityManagerpublic List<DeadLetterJobEntity> findJobsByProcessInstanceId(String id)
DeadLetterJobEntityManagerDeadLetterJobEntity instances related to a process instancefindJobsByProcessInstanceId in interface DeadLetterJobEntityManagerpublic List<Job> findJobsByQueryCriteria(DeadLetterJobQueryImpl jobQuery)
DeadLetterJobEntityManagerJobQueryImpl and returns the matching DeadLetterJobEntity instances.findJobsByQueryCriteria in interface DeadLetterJobEntityManagerpublic long findJobCountByQueryCriteria(DeadLetterJobQueryImpl jobQuery)
DeadLetterJobEntityManagerDeadLetterJobEntityManager.findJobsByQueryCriteria(DeadLetterJobQueryImpl), but only returns a count and not the instances itself.findJobCountByQueryCriteria in interface DeadLetterJobEntityManagerpublic void updateJobTenantIdForDeployment(String deploymentId, String newTenantId)
DeadLetterJobEntityManagerDeploymentEntity.updateJobTenantIdForDeployment in interface DeadLetterJobEntityManagerpublic void insert(DeadLetterJobEntity jobEntity, boolean fireCreateEvent)
insert in interface EntityManager<DeadLetterJobEntity>insert in class AbstractEntityManager<DeadLetterJobEntity>public void insert(DeadLetterJobEntity jobEntity)
insert in interface EntityManager<DeadLetterJobEntity>insert in class AbstractEntityManager<DeadLetterJobEntity>public void delete(DeadLetterJobEntity jobEntity)
delete in interface EntityManager<DeadLetterJobEntity>delete in class AbstractEntityManager<DeadLetterJobEntity>protected DeadLetterJobEntity createDeadLetterJob(AbstractRuntimeJobEntity job)
protected DeadLetterJobDataManager getDataManager()
getDataManager in class AbstractEntityManager<DeadLetterJobEntity>public void setJobDataManager(DeadLetterJobDataManager jobDataManager)
Copyright © 2018 Flowable. All rights reserved.